Default Toothpaste

I removed a few scratches with toothpaste and a terry cloth towel. Use a little toothpaste and buff on well. Its the sand/grit that is in the toothpaste that removes the scratches. Also rubbing compound words good. Also the fine grit in the compound is what does the job.
